2 heterozygous brown-eyed people are crossed. What are the possible genotypes and phenotypes of their offspring? (use the letters B/b) (Blue eyes are recessive)

Genotypes- 1 BB, 1bb, 2Bb     Phenotypes- 3 brown eye and 1 Blue eye

Define Phenotype and Genotype. 

A phenotype is the appearance of an organism based on its genotype. It is an observable trait of an organism.

A genotype is the genetic makeup of an organism. It has two alleles in the cell, one from each parent which can be the same or diffrent.
